What are the fence height rules for my South Park property?
South Park Township zoning limits fences to 4 feet in front yards and 6 feet in rear yards. A 0-foot setback is permissible, allowing installation directly on the property line. For corner lots, a 'sight triangle' regulation applies. This requires a clear visibility zone at intersections, especially near PA-88. Fences within this triangle typically must be under 3 feet tall and not opaque.
Can I have a smart gate with a pool?
Yes, but the gate must meet IRC Appendix AG pool code. The latch must be self-closing, self-latching, and placed 54 inches above grade. We integrate smart IoT gate operators with these mechanical latches. This provides remote access while maintaining the physical safety standard required by Pennsylvania law. A smart lock alone does not satisfy the code for a pool barrier.
Who pays for a fence on the property line in South Park, PA?
Pennsylvania common law governs this as a 'partition fence.' Shared cost is not mandatory without a prior written agreement. A 2026 legal best practice requires notifying your neighbor in South Park with a certified letter before replacing a shared boundary. This creates a record and can prevent future disputes over the property line. We advise consulting a real estate attorney for formal agreements.
Is a standard fence strong enough for South Park storms?
A standard 8-foot panel on 8-foot centers will fail. Engineering for 115 MPH V-ult wind speed dictates tighter 6-foot post spacing, deeper footings, and commercial-grade wind brackets. The South Park Fairgrounds area has high exposure. We design to ASCE 7-22 standards to resist peak storm season gusts, which often exceed the rated wind load.
What happens before you dig the first post hole?
We call Pennsylvania 811 for a full utility locate. Hitting a gas or fiber line in South Park Township is a major liability causing service outages and fines. We then pull the required permit from the South Park Township permit office. This process verifies zoning compliance for your lot and ensures the fence is a legal structure. It typically adds 7-10 days to the project start.

What fence material lasts longest in South Park?
Use G90 galvanized or powder-coated steel for moderate soil corrosivity. Aluminum is also suitable. Pressure-treated wood is standard, but South Park has a moderate termite risk. We use ground-contact rated lumber and stainless steel or coated fasteners. Standard galvanized nails can rust, causing unsightly streaks on the fence face within two seasons.
